The Big Brother Nigeria season 6 reality TV show has just kicked off and housemates have started to introduce themselves. The first housemate that was introduced is identified as Boma. Boma is a 34-year old model that is very cheerful and loud.
Boma is also a Mixologist, actor and masseuse. According to him, he has been modelling for over 10 years now. He got into Mixology when he was living in Europe and he had a severe injury when he was about to sign a contract. Because of this injury, he had to return to New York.
At New York, a friend of his introduced him to events, bartending and mixology to he got acquainted to the occupation. He is an athletic person too because he got the injury from football.
